Gregg Henson has published a new article on his website alleging that more than 450 former football players signed a petition and presented it to the Regents to have Dave Brandon removed. 

Among other things, there's an alleged email exceprt from a "former football captain" that lists all the things the players can't stand about Brandon. If you like juicy info and potentional conspiracy theories, this piece is chock-full.

If any or all of this is true, look out, fireworks may actually start happening around the Big House.

The rumblings were that he was forced out. If you followed it, he was transitioned from being SID and an Associate Athletic Director, IIRC, to what was essentially a much reduced role during the last couple years, then was asked to retire. I've heard from several corners that it wasn't a voluntary move. The big shocker is there are rumblings about Jon Falk being forced out as well.

When you look at the absurdly high level of turnover in the AD since DB took over, neither seems surprising. He clearly wants his own people in there.
